An examination of the Tsuki-52 continues…

Earth-11: Here, everyone on Earth and beyond is of opposite genders. Meet Usagi, aka the fabled "Moon Prince" and the soldier of Honor and Justice "Sailor Moon". Together with his "Sailor Knights", Usagi fights a never-ending battle against the forces of Chaos. Too bad his personal life is not as straight forward, given that the future King of Crystal Tokyo has a harem to deal with, such as his first love Mamoko (aka "Tuxedo Kamen"), his other love Ranko Saotome, his endearing love Beta Ray Billi (protector of Asgard), his strange love Countess Vlatka (a vampire lady) and soul companion Miyamoto (a Sekirei). This is on top of the fact that Usagi has had many relationships over a considerable lifetime, resulting in fathering a number of children, hence the reason why the Moon Prince is determined to keep Earth safe from harm, on Earth and beyond.

Earth-12: When Sailor Chaos and Sailor Cosmos battled in Null Space (i.e. the gaps between dimensions), the effects of that battle spilled over onto this Earth, resulting in every man, woman and child being wiped out. Feeling guilty for her carelessness, Sailor Cosmos used her power to bring the victims of her battle back to life. Unfortunately, thanks to Sailor Chaos' interference, everyone who was brought back to life, either as duplicates of the Moon Princess herself (if the victim was originally born female), or looking like a male version of the Moon Princess (if the victim was originally born male), including the Sailor Scouts, Nerima Wrecking Crew and others of that Earth. Making matters worse, some on this world is actively seeking revenge on Sailor Cosmos for what was done to them and their world, even if they have to cross over into other worlds to find the culprit…

Earth-13: The Mythic Age never went away, thus the word of magic and mysticism continues to be strong, thanks to the merging of humankind and supernatural. Now, Usagi is a vampire princess. Ami is a witchling. Minako is a succubus. Rei is a fire elemental. Makoto is a werewolf. Hotaru is a snow girl. Haruka is a seraph. Michiru is a mermaid. Guided by the mysterious ghost named Setsuna, these "Scouts of Shadows" protects a world in perpetual twilight, rather than be plunged into eternal darkness by the forces of Chaos.

Earth-14: A world where only the Sailor Scouts exists (i.e. manga canon).

Earth-15: Where as the 13th Earth exists in perpetual twilight, this Earth was plunged into darkness completely, when the Human, Beast Men and Demon Worlds became as one. Known colloquially as "Cancer Earth", this world's Sailor Scouts are dark and distorted parodies of their former selves, as are the rest of what used to be humanity. And within each being exists a fragment of the so-called "Watcher of the Deep", who may be Cthulu itself, or one of its many avatars and minions. Not surprisingly, Earth-15 and its universe have been sectioned off from the other sub-universes by the Council of Pluto(s), for obvious reasons.

Earth-16: A world where only Ranma and the so-called "Nerima Wrecking Crew" exists (i.e. manga canon).

Earth-17: The Cuban Missile Crisis of 1962 did not end with a whimper, but with a bang! The nuclear exchange between the US and the USSR led to World War III. Years later, Usagi, armed with the mysterious martial arts known as the "Moon Fist", and her friends protect what's left of humanity from roving bands of madmen and mutants in a post-nuclear world, even as the Cult of Chaos, led by Beryl the Conqueror, seeks to wipe what's worth fighting for.

Earth-18: On this world, the Moon Princess and her royal court are reborn in the Old West of 19th Century America. On this world, Usagi is a young gunslinger who seeks to promote Love and Justice in a world of outlaws, led by Ma Beryl and her gang. Rounding out her crew is Amy (young nurse), Mina (showgirl), Reye (shamanist), Lyta (rancher), Heather (farmer), Alex (sheriff's deputy), Michelle (saloon hall owner) and Susana (school teacher). Occasionally, Usagi is helped by the mysterious "The Lone Mask", who has a penchant for red roses…

Earth-19: Caught between tradition and progress is the Meiji Restoration; within this time is Usagi, a youma hunter who vows to protect others from evil, who also wields the fabled "Moon Scythe", given to her by the God Tsukuyomi. Helping her is Ami, daughter of a doctor. There is Minako, a geisha who serves as a spy for the Meiji government. There is Rei, a shrine maiden. There is Makoto, daughter of a local blacksmith. There is Hotaru, daughter of a prominent scholar. There is Haruka, a young, former samurai hiding a secret. There is Michiru, daughter of a fisherman, and gifted in the playing of the "koto". Guided by Setsuna, a court lady, Usagi and her friends serve the Emperor as his secret warrior maidens, occasionally assisted by the court advisor Lord Mamoru, an up-and-coming nobleman.

Earth-20: It is the 1930s, a time of high adventures and two-fisted tales. The Society of Scouts, led by the daughter of an archeologist, travels the world with her fellow scouts on global expeditions, hoping to survive the strange and unknown while combating the forces of Madame Beryl and her Dark Kingdom!
